We have an exciting opportunity for a Civil/Structural Engineer to join the Infrastructure Design Authority (IDA) at Raynesway in Derby, supporting satellite sites. We are undertaking a significant redevelopment and expansion to provide new buildings and infrastructure in support of propulsion systems for submarines in the Royal Navy and Australia.
As the Engineering Lead – Civil/Structural, you will provide technical oversight from concept to detailed design as well as supporting and maintaining our legacy buildings and infrastructure across the submarine’s estate.
What you will be doing:
- Developing and assuring Facility Design Authority standards, processes and procedures are applied to enable safe and successful delivery of new build and modified facilities and infrastructure.
- Providing appropriate technical oversight of Infrastructure design, construction and commissioning activities for facilities/infrastructure projects commissioned by the Submarines Business, in conjunction with other stakeholders.
- Acting as the Civil/Structural Engineering Intelligent Customer for all matters relating to nuclear and conventional facilities, structures and associated Infrastructure within the Submarines business.
- Providing design, modification and build assurance of the Civil/Structural Infrastructure to the Submarines Business and appropriate Rolls-Royce Design Authorities.
- Assuring appropriate maintenance/inspection of the Civil/Structural Infrastructure at Raynesway as part of a team.
Position / Qualifications:
- Experienced Structural Engineer with broad experience in design and/or verification.
- Flexibility to work in a wide variety of roles, from small to medium works and maintenance to complex new build design and construction.
- Ability to appraise calculations, drawings and proposals from concept to construction relative to the latest Euro Codes, British Standards, Codes of Practice, Guidance Documents.
- Strong meeting and communication skills to ensure the technical requirements are met whilst ensuring appropriate solutions are derived and difficulties overcome through the design and construction process.
- Experience in temporary works, groundworks, roads, bridges, drainage design and flood mitigation would be desirable.
- A desire to build new skills or develop them further in the Nuclear/safety critical environment would be an advantage.
Preferred:
- Chartered or Incorporated Civil or Structural Engineer (IStructE or ICE).
- Engineering (BEng or MEng).
To work for Rolls-Royce Submarines, you need to hold a Security Check (SC) clearance without any caveats to that clearance. Rolls-Royce will support the application for Security Clearance if you don’t currently have this in place. Due to the nature of work the business conducts and the protection of certain assets, you must hold UK nationality. Any dual nationals will require additional scrutiny and background checks prior to commencing work with RRSL.
